The long awaited partnership between Fortnite and The Simpsons launches on Saturday. Players dive into Springfield Island for a fast paced Battle Royale experience. The map supports 80 player matches and invites fans to explore familiar locations like Krusty Burger, the Kwik‑E‑Mart, and the nuclear power plant.
Each week in November the game adds fresh gameplay twists. The Springfield Battle Pass brings outfits such as Homer, Marge and Ned Flanders. It also introduces Simpsons versions of Fortnite characters like Blinky Fishstick and Springfielder Peely. Fans can unlock alternate looks like Evil Homer and Witch Marge during the Treehouse of Horror events.
Weekly Shorts and Map Updates
Four original Simpsons shorts will premiere on Fortnite each week, starting on November 1. The episodes act as previews for the week’s map changes and story beats. The titles are Apocalypse D’oh, Sugar High, Multiplidiocy and The Incredible Bulk. Players can watch the shorts on Fortnite’s social channels, the quests tab under animated shorts, and on Disney+.

Sidekicks, Challenges and Cross Platform Fun
The battle pass also introduces the first of Fortnite’s Sidekicks. Peels appears as an exclusive companion in the Springfield battle pass and remains available until more sidekicks arrive on November 7.
Outside of Fortnite, the Rocket League x The Simpsons limited time event adds extra challenges. Players drive around Springfield to earn items such as the Blinky Topper, Homer’s Hedges Player Banner and Waste Wheels. Each unlimited challenge rewards 20,000 XP, encouraging players to keep playing.
Disney and Epic Games Partnership
The Simpsons owner Disney invested 1.5 billion in Epic Games last year. That deal paves the way for a shared universe that could include Disney, Pixar, Marvel, Star Wars, Avatar and more. The collaboration runs on Epic Games’ Unreal Engine, delivering high quality visuals and smooth gameplay.
